TICKETS NOW ON SALE FOR ROLLING WHEELS RACEWAY WORLD OF OUTLAWS SPRINTS AND LATE MODELS
By Dave Roberts
DIRTcar Northeast PR
 
WEEDSPORT, NY_ Race fans rejoyce! Reserve tickets for two of the bigger events on the DIRTcar Northeast 2010 schedule are now on sale.
The World of Outlaws Sprints, scheduled for Super DIRT Week 2010 on Saturday, October 9th and the World of Outlaws Late Models on Thursday, August 19th are both made for the five-eighths mile oval. Known as an extremely fast track, both the Sprints and the Late Models will be put to the test as some of the best drivers in the United States make their only 2010 appearance to the Elbridge, NY facility.
Last season, the World of Outlaws Sprints played before one of the largest crowds in Rolling Wheels Raceway history.
Reserve tickets for the World of Outlaws Sprints are $35. The World of Outlaws Late Models tickets are $30.

SUMMIT AUTO GROUP CUSTOMER APPRECIATION DAYS TO FEATURE DIRTCAR NORTHEAST DRIVERS
by Dave Roberts, DIRTcar Northeast PR
WEEDSPORT, NEW YORK_ DIRTcar Northeast race fans in the Central New York region will get an early look at some of their favorite drivers when Summit Auto Group of Auburn, NY will host a car show with 2010 competitors from Canandaigua Speedway, Cayuga County Fair Speedway and Rolling Wheels Raceway. 
Billed as the "Summit Auto Group Customer Appreciation Days," race fans will have plenty to look at as better than a dozen competitors are expected to showcase their off-season efforts before going onto the local race tracks in just a few weeks time.
"The car show at Summit Auto Group give our race fans a "sneak peak" at what they'll see for the upcoming season," says Cayuga County, Canandaigua and Rolling Wheels Raceway General Manager Cory Reed.
"We really appreciate what our friends at Summit Auto Group are doing for local short track racing."
The dates for the two day program will be on Friday, April 2nd and Saturday, April 3rd. Times for those days will be Friday from 10am to 8pm and Saturday from 10am to 5pm. Summit Auto Group is the official pace car sponsor for the Cayuga County Fair Speedway and the Rolling Wheels Raceway
Summit will have food and refreshments available. Track schedules from Cayuga County, Canandaigua and Rolling Wheels Raceway will also be available. Verizon Fios will also be on hand with giveaways.
In addition to that, anyone taking a test drive of a Summit Auto Group car will be given a pair of tickets to the Cayuga County Fair Speedway opener on Sunday, April 18. Fans will also be able to register to win a general admission season's pass for the 2010 Cayuga County Fair Speedway schedule. There will also be a number of second and third place prizes as well.  The Finger Lakes Radio Group will also be on hand playing music.

CAYUGA COUNTY FAIR SPEEDWAY AND CANANDAIGUA SPEEDWAY LUCKY FAMILY VIP DRAW FOR 2010.

by Dave Roberts  
DIRTcar Northeast PR
 WEEDSPORT, NEW YORK_ Race fans who purchase the Family Four-Pack weekly at the Cayuga County Fair Speedway and the Canandaigua Speedway during the 2010 season will have a chance to better their seating arrangement when they come through the gates of both Central New York DIRTcar Northeast facilities..
The Lucky Family VIP Draw will become a standard procedure every week during the upcoming season. For those purchasing the Lucky Family VIP Draw, they will immediately enter a drawing that will take place later in the evening. For that family winning the drawing, they will immediately be upgraded to the VIP Towers following the heat races for exciting feature racing action.
"DIRTcar Northeast short track racing is a family based entertainment. We'd like to see more families come to the race track. With the incentive we are offering with the Lucky Family VIP Draw, we hope that many of our race fans will take advantage of it," says Cory Reed, General Manager of Canandaigua, Cayuga County and Rolling Wheels Raceway.
The Family Four-Pack consists of two adult and two children general admission passes. In addition to that, they'll receive four hamburgers and /or hot dogs and four soft drinks. The cost of the program is just $40.
The Family Four-Pack will also be supported during special events, but at graduated prices.

ALYSHA RUGGLES CHOSEN AS MISS ROLLING WHEELS RACEWAY AND MISS CAYUGA COUNTY FAIR SPEEDWAY
by Dave Roberts
DIRTcar Northeast PR
WEEDSPORT, NY_ Canandaigua, New York high school student Alysha Ruggles has been chosen by DIRTcar Northeast and it's race tracks Cayuga County Fair Speedway and Rolling Wheels Raceway for the 2010 season as it's victory lane representative.
Alysha, who finished second in the Ms DIRT Motorsports contest on Saturday night at the Syracuse Motorsports Expo, is the daughter of veteran racer Darryl Ruggles, who now is a regular with the 600cc Modified Midget traveling series. Ironically, Alysha is also a competitor with the 600 Modified Midget group as well.
Alysha is thrilled with the opportunity to represent Rolling Wheels Raceway and Cayuga County Fair Speedway for the 2010 season.
"It's a real honor and privilage," said Alysha, who spent much of her time at the Expo with her race car talking to race fans about the upcoming 2010 season. "I've been to those two tracks a lot watching my dad race so I'm really excited about my participation here."
Alysha will be at most races. In fact, she'll be racing at several shows as the Modified Midget 600 class will be at Cayuga County six times during the 2010 season. Her best finish away from Paradise Speedway, where she's won several times, was a second place showing at Ransomville Speedway in 2009. She finished right behind her dad in the event.
Alysha looks forward to representing both Rolling Wheels Raceway and Cayuga County Fair Speedway with professionalism.

APRILL GREY WINS MS DIRT MOTORSPORTS PAGEANT
By Dave Roberts
DIRTcar Northeast PR
SYRACUSE, NEW YORK_ Aprill Grey of Daytona Beach, Florida won the Ms DIRT Motorsports competition last Saturday night in the Center of Progress building at the New York State Fairgrounds.
The event was a part of the Syracuse Motorsports Expo put on by Gater Racing News.
Aprill had been in the pageant before but this was her first time coming out as a winner.
“I was a little nervous coming into this because I had lost before,” said Aprill following the pageant. “I just want to represent racing and go to as many shows as possible.”
Although Aprill admits that nothing is “set in stone,” she claims to have a three race ride in a DIRTcar Sportsman for the upcoming season. The circumstances behind the three race deal has yet to be determined.
Finishing second was Alysha Ruggles, a second generation driver from Canandaigua, New York. Alysha is the daughter of 600cc Modified Midget driver Darryl Ruggles, who has also driven DIRTcar Modifieds in the past. Alysha is also a driver of the 600cc Modified Midgets. It was also announced last Sunday afternoon that Alysha will represent Cayuga County Fair Speedway and Rolling Wheels Raceway in victory lane for the 2010 season.
Third went to Claire Spangler.
Aprill Grey received $500 from Pageant organizers. The event was also sponsored by Leaf Racewear.
Other canadates in the pageant included Samantha Hendler of Lyons, New York; Dayla Sheas of Johnson City, NewYork and Nina Nicole.
